Mory Sacko
Mory Sacko (born September 24, 1992) is a Senegal-born French chef. He gained prominence to the public during his participation in the eleventh season of Top Chef, he opened his Parisian restaurant MoSuke in September 2020 and obtained the rewards of several gastronomic guides after a few weeks of opening, in particular a Michelin star in January 2021. From February 2021, he hosts the weekly television program Cuisine Ouverte broadcast every Saturday at 8:20 pm on France 3.[1][2][3]
